aboutsummaryrefslogtreecommitdiffstats
path: root/rest_framework/tests/request.py
diff options
context:
space:
mode:
authorMichal Dvorak (cen38289)2012-12-21 10:53:23 +0100
committerMichal Dvorak (cen38289)2012-12-21 10:53:23 +0100
commit5ba2437f2dcb4eb7f9677ff9e393c27af38b071f (patch)
treedf19512bc58ae3180813c9d479267b7a617e9b8e /rest_framework/tests/request.py
parent8ac77eaae8d6ad01ec8f6de18134c4aa1961d4dd (diff)
parent79aea2f0d082f17e7bb75cc32bd71b5f04836d43 (diff)
downloaddjango-rest-framework-5ba2437f2dcb4eb7f9677ff9e393c27af38b071f.tar.bz2
Merge remote-tracking branch 'tom/master'
Conflicts: rest_framework/tests/serializer.py
Diffstat (limited to 'rest_framework/tests/request.py')
-rw-r--r--rest_framework/tests/request.py13
1 files changed, 10 insertions, 3 deletions
diff --git a/rest_framework/tests/request.py b/rest_framework/tests/request.py
index 2850992d..1f05ff8f 100644
--- a/rest_framework/tests/request.py
+++ b/rest_framework/tests/request.py
@@ -1,16 +1,15 @@
"""
Tests for content parsing, and form-overloaded content parsing.
"""
-from django.conf.urls.defaults import patterns
from django.contrib.auth.models import User
from django.contrib.auth import authenticate, login, logout
from django.contrib.sessions.middleware import SessionMiddleware
from django.test import TestCase, Client
+from django.test.client import RequestFactory
from django.utils import simplejson as json
-
from rest_framework import status
from rest_framework.authentication import SessionAuthentication
-from django.test.client import RequestFactory
+from rest_framework.compat import patterns
from rest_framework.parsers import (
BaseParser,
FormParser,
@@ -304,3 +303,11 @@ class TestUserSetter(TestCase):
self.assertFalse(self.request.user.is_anonymous())
logout(self.request)
self.assertTrue(self.request.user.is_anonymous())
+
+
+class TestAuthSetter(TestCase):
+
+ def test_auth_can_be_set(self):
+ request = Request(factory.get('/'))
+ request.auth = 'DUMMY'
+ self.assertEqual(request.auth, 'DUMMY')